Step Away From the Scale!

Every year at my fitness studio, Brickhouse Cardio Club - Stafford, VA, I run several fitness challenges to keep my members motivated, and I am always torn by having to use the scale in these challenges. Most of us are competitive by nature, so the idea of winning a challenge (and bragging rights), winning money, and losing weight in the process is a no brainer! But here is the problem with a weight loss challenge: THE SCALE DOES NOT TELL THE WHOLE STORY!

I like to take photos of members, take measurements of their bodies, and ask them about how their clothes (especially jeans) fit when I notice their bodies are changing. Studies show that our body weight fluctuates from day to day based on several things including what we eat, how much sleep we get, whether we are stressed out, whether we are retaining fluids, and whether we are consistently working out.  Get this, you will weigh more if you add lean muscle mass to your body!  Gaining muscle and losing fat does not show up on the scale.  However, your body composition is changing for the better!  While we are using the scale, please do not get discouraged over one to three pound fluctuations. If you know that you are not mentally prepared to ignore the scale when you know that your body is changing, step away from the scale, and focus on what really matters, which is your improving health and fitness.
